🙂A single person spends $369 per month in Francistown vs $610 in Tlokweng,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$606 per month in Francistown vs $971 in Tlokweng,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$842 per month in Francistown vs $1,331 in Tlokweng, rent included.
🙂Francistown is about 39% cheaper than Tlokweng, driven mainly by Monthly Utilities & Internet.
📊Both Francistown and Tlokweng are more affordable than the global median – Francistown72% lower, Tlokweng54% lower.
